08:02 AM EST, 12/11/2024 (MT Newswires) -- Boralex ( BRLXF ) said Wednesday that the company and its partner, Six Nations of the Grand River Development, closed a $538 million financing for the Hagersville Battery Energy Storage Park in Ontario.
The park will have a capacity of 300 MW/1,200 MWh, making it the biggest battery energy storage project to date in Canada once it reaches commissioning, Boralex ( BRLXF ) said.
The financing package includes a $366 million construction loan, a $141 million bridge loan and a $31 million letter of credit facility.

The financing was provided by a banking syndicate comprising Sumitomo Mitsui Banking, Canada Branch; KfW Ipex-Bank; the Korean Development Bank; Credit Industriel et Commercial; and New York Branch et DZ Bank.
